study guides for every class

that actually explain what's on your next test

Availability

from class:

Cybersecurity and Cryptography

Definition

Availability refers to the assurance that information and resources are accessible to authorized users when needed. It emphasizes the importance of keeping systems operational and minimizing downtime to ensure users can access necessary data, services, or applications. High availability is crucial in various contexts, including cybersecurity, where it impacts not only user experience but also business operations and continuity planning.

congrats on reading the definition of Availability.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Availability is one of the key components of the CIA triad, which also includes confidentiality and integrity, highlighting its critical role in cybersecurity.
  2. High availability solutions often incorporate technologies such as load balancing, failover systems, and backup power supplies to ensure continued access.
  3. Maintaining availability can involve regular software updates and patches to prevent vulnerabilities that could lead to downtime or service interruptions.
  4. In cloud computing, service level agreements (SLAs) define the expected availability percentage, often targeting 99.9% uptime or higher.
  5. Natural disasters, hardware failures, and cyber attacks are common threats to availability, making it essential for organizations to implement comprehensive disaster recovery plans.

Review Questions

  • How does availability interact with the other components of the CIA triad?
    • Availability interacts closely with confidentiality and integrity in the CIA triad by ensuring that users not only have access to data but can trust that it is accurate and protected from unauthorized access. If a system's availability is compromised due to a cyber attack or technical failure, it can lead to significant business disruptions. Furthermore, ensuring high availability often requires balancing security measures that may otherwise restrict access, showing how all three components must be managed together.
  • What strategies can organizations employ to enhance the availability of their critical systems?
    • Organizations can enhance availability through various strategies such as implementing redundancy by having backup servers or data centers ready to take over during failures. Load balancing can help distribute user demand evenly across multiple servers, reducing the risk of any single point of failure. Regular maintenance and proactive monitoring also play a crucial role in identifying potential issues before they impact service availability.
  • Evaluate the impact of a Denial of Service attack on system availability and discuss potential mitigation strategies.
    • A Denial of Service attack severely impacts system availability by overwhelming a server with traffic, rendering it inaccessible to legitimate users. This type of attack disrupts business operations and can damage an organizationโ€™s reputation. To mitigate such risks, organizations can deploy firewalls and intrusion detection systems that recognize and filter out malicious traffic. Additionally, employing rate limiting and engaging cloud-based DDoS protection services can help absorb excess traffic during an attack.
ยฉ 2024 Fiveable Inc. All rights reserved.
APยฎ and SATยฎ are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.
Glossary
Guides